So this weekend my roommate our friend AJ and I went to Ibiza which is an island off the coast of Spain, this is the first time I've been on an island too. It's super beautiful, but it's kind of dead until May when it's in season. Apparently it's like no other thing during the summer. Tons of stuff to do and tons of people everywhere! We arrived in San Antoni Thursday night and hit the local bars. It was the Pintxo festival so there were tons of people out and about. The next day we just did some exploring and went to the beach. We found a little market too so I enjoyed shopping around there too. Like I said many things are closed this time of year so we didn't do a whole lot of activities so to speak. Saturday we decided to move to the other side of the island which was way more poppin in terms of things to do. We walked around for awhile in Ibiza town and got some dinner. We rented a super cute apartment for the night with an incredible view of the ocean and port. Saturday night we went to this world famous club called Pacha. Clubs really are not my thing, but it was fun and absolutely huge. My roommate also met a guy who works on a yacht so we hung out at his yacht on Sunday. No big deal or anything....Also the funniest thing happened to me too. Stephanie and I went to grab some food and I sat down while Stephanie was ordering. Next thing I knew, about 10 fourteen year old boys were all around me talking to me. It was quite funny and they didn't speak much English, but they did know quite a few jokes so that was entertaining. They were enamored with us and they kept us laughing for a good ten minutes. If only we were that luck with men our own age.. hahaha
Overall it was kind of just a relaxing weekend away from the city. It was incredibly beautiful as well. I will definitely try to make it back someday during the summer when the whole island is crawling with people and things to do!
